  • I cannot send an email from my iPad 2? No problem receiving, why does this happen? Have tried the suggestions for setting up email and after doing the sync mail through iTunes receiving worked great but still cannot send? Any help would be great

    I cannot send an email from my iPad 2? No problem receiving, why does this happen? Have tried the suggestions for setting up email and after doing the sync mail through iTunes receiving worked great but still cannot send? Any help would be great!

    The fact that you can receive means you have a valid e mail address, and have established the connection to the incoming server, so all of that works.  Since the send does not work, that means your outgoing server is rejecting whatever settings you used formthe outgoing set up.  Try them again. 
    Google your particular isp, and ipad and many times you will find the exact settings needed for your isp.  Or tell us here, and soneone else may be on the same isp.  Some mail services need you to change a port, or have a unique name for the outgoing server.

  • How do I set up a rescue email adress after initial sign up?

    I want to know how to set a rescue email adress after initial signup to itunes so I can reset my security questions, when i go to the security questions it does not give me the option to reset like in all other guides. I am in Australia if this is a regional thing.

    It's not due to your location, you won't be able to add a rescue email address until you can answer 2 of your questions, so you will need to get them reset first. You can either try contacting iTunes Support or Apple to do so : https://discussions.apple.com/docs/DOC-4551
    e.g. you can try contacting iTunes Support : http://www.apple.com/support/itunes/contact/ - click on Contact iTunes Store Support on the right-hand side of the page, then Account Management , and then try Apple ID Account Security
    or try ringing Apple in your country and ask to talk to the Accounts Security Team : http://support.apple.com/kb/HE57
    When you've got them reset you can then add a rescue email address via the screen that you've included for potential future use.

  • Performance degradation after setting filesystemio_option=setall from none.

    Hi All,
    We have facing performance degradation after setting filesystemio_option=setall from none on my two servers as mentioned below.
    Red Hat Enterprise Linux AS release 4 (Nahant Update 7) 2.6.9 55.ELhugemem (32-bit)
    Red Hat Enterprise Linux Server release 5.2 (Tikanga) 2.6.18 92.1.10.el5 (64-bit)
    We are seeing lots of Disk I/O happening. We expected "*filesystemio_option=setall* " will improve performance but it is degrading. We getting slowness complains.
    Please let me know do we need to set somethign else along with this ...like any otimizer parameter( e.g. optimizer_index_cost_adj, optimizer_index_caching).
    Please help.

    Hi Suraj,
    <speculation>
    You switched filesystemio_options to setall from none, so, the most likely reason for performance degradation after switching to setall is the implementation of directio. Direct I/O will skip the filesystem buffer cache, and and allow Oracle to read directly from disk to the database buffer cache. However, on a system where direct I/O is not implemented, which is what you had until you recently messed with that parameter, it's likely that you had an undersized database buffer cache, but that was ok, because many (most) of the physical I/Os your database was doing, were actually being serviced by the O/S filesystem buffer cache. But, you introduced direct I/O, and wiped out the ability of the O/S to service any physical I/Os from filesystem buffer cache. This means that every cache miss on the database buffer cache, turns into a real, physical, spin-the-disk, move-the-drive-head, physical I/O. And, you are suffering the performance consequences.
    </speculation>
    Ok, end of speculation. Now, assuming that what I've outlined above is actually going on, what to do? Why is direct I/O lower performing than buffered, non-direct I/O? Shouldn't it's performance be superior?
    Well, when you have an established system that's using buffered I/O, and you switch to direct I/O, you almost always will have to increase the size of the database buffer cache. The problem is that you took a huge chunk of memory away from the the O/S, that it was using to buffer your I/Os and avoid physical I/O. So, now, you need to make up for it, by increasing the size of the database buffer cache. You can do this, without buying more memory for the box, because the O/S is no longer going to need to use so much memory for filesystem buffers.
    So, what to do? Is it worth switching? Well, on balance, it makes sense to use direct I/O, and give Oracle a larger database buffer cache, for the simple fact that (particularly on a server that's dedicated to being an Oracle database server), Oracle has far more sophisticated caching algorithms, and a better understanding of the various types of data being cached, and so should be able to make more efficient use of the memory, than the (relatively) brain dead caching algorithms of the kernel and filesystem mechanisms.
    But, once again, it all comes down to this:
    What problem are you trying to solve? Did you have any I/O related issues? Do you have any compelling reason to implement direct I/O? Rule #1 is "if it ain't broke, don't fix it." Did you just violate rule #1? :-)
    Finally, since you're on Linux, you can use the 'free' command to see how much memory is on the box, how much is free, and how much is dedicated to filesystem cache buffers. This response is already pretty long, so, I'm not going to get into details, however, if you're not familiar with the command, the results could be misleading. Read the man page, and try to be clear about understanding it before you make any assumptions about the output.
